The syllabus of BSc Physician Assistant is generally considered moderate. Students need to study topics like anatomy, physiology, surgery assistance, and patient care.
It can feel challenging at times, especially during clinical training, but with consistent practice and interest in healthcare, most students manage it successfully.

Students can pick from various speacializations in BSc course as their undergraduate degree programme in Science. Various subjects under bachelor's of Science course include Computer Science, Zoology, Chemistry, Biology, Biotechnology, Botany, Mathematics, Physics, Statistics, etc.
Each BSc subject specialisation continues for an average duration of 3 to 4 years. Students are advised to choose the BSc subject based on their subject of interest. Students must check the admission eligibility of BSc courses before applying.
